Retired CMSAF Wright, Alex Toussaint discuss mental health awareness with JBA Airmen

By Airman 1st Class Matthew-John Braman 316th Wing Public Affairs

Retired Chief Master Sgt. of the Air Force Kaleth O. Wright and cycling instructor Alex Toussaint discussed with Airmen how to improve and bring awareness to mental health, April 19, 2022, at Joint Base Andrews, Md.

The two used their past experiences and personal stories to highlight important points throughout the “Do Better Foundation” event. The foundation’s mission is to democratize wellness by promoting and providing access to wellness services and resources.

Toussaint later donated two pieces of exercise equipment to the JBA Tactical Fitness Center during a ribbon cutting ceremony. The donation was Toussaint’s way of kick-starting his foundation's mission.
